Description For Data Scientist, Customer Service

The Device, Digital & Alexa Support (D2AS) team at Amazon is seeking a Data Scientist to revolutionize customer service experiences. This role combines technical expertise with business acumen to drive meaningful improvements in customer support. You'll lead modeling projects, develop data-driven insights, and design statistical experiments to optimize product decisions. The position offers an opportunity to work with cutting-edge technology and collaborate with cross-functional teams including scientists, engineers, and product leaders.

The role involves working with various data sources and technologies, including Redshift, SQL Server, Oracle DW, and Salesforce. You'll be responsible for implementing machine learning algorithms, conducting statistical analyses, and creating user-friendly analytical tools. The team's mission is to make digital experiences effortless for customers by anticipating, evaluating, preventing, and eliminating customer effort.

D2AS focuses on setting the strategy for digital support and accelerating the delivery of seamless support experiences across Amazon's digital products. The team combines strategic thinking, technology expertise, and customer experience best practices to ensure customers can easily maximize value from Amazon's digital offerings. Responsibilities For Data Scientist, Customer Service

  • Lead modeling projects to enhance customer service experience
  • Design and run experiments, research new algorithms to improve CX analytics
  • Research and implement machine learning algorithms for business needs
  • Partner with scientists, engineers and product leaders to solve business problems
  • Collaborate with BI/Data Engineer teams for data collection and refinement
  • Manipulate/mine data from databases (Redshift, SQL Server, Oracle DW, Salesforce)
  • Provide analytical network support to improve quality
